    Then I went to google and search for information about that so I just read on some forums 'Ignore that'
    So you seem to have read forum threads from 2012 or older and were only ONE click away from the right current advice on page one all the time. Don't make the same mistake on forums again, never just stay on the first random thread that Google throws at you and not notice the date of the discussion - you only ever need one click to get to page one of the forum an old thread is archived on! See my signature below which tells people where to click and tells people not to ignore these.

    The NEWBIES thread covers all your queries and there's a whole post about boring debt collector letters. It's at the top of page one (one click away, as per my signature, use the blue breadcrumb trail link at the top of the page to always find your way back home to page one from any thread you read). No more discussion needed really, it's all there. You missed a trick, should have appealed and won like we all do and have advised for well over a year. But so what, really, it's no big deal and a keeper is NOT liable re a fake PCN on Airport land.
    how long it will take because if I have to spend on that a lot of time probably I prefer to just pay it.
    No you wouldn't, as keeper you are not even liable! It's just some letters, come on! Do you pay off phishing emailers too?!

    Please search the forum for Roxburghe and just read other threads as this has been discussed to death and new threads about the letters just aren't needed (sorry but they are not, the info is already on other threads from 2014 and we've seen enough of the letters). Use 'search this forum' next to 'forum tools' on page one of the parking forum above the NEWBIES sticky thread.

    Put in Roxburghe and change the default search to 'show posts', make a cup of coffee and bore yourself senseless reading the umpteen zillion threads from people asking the same questions day in day out, getting the same letter chain as you.

    Personally I wouldn't bother to reply at all to Roxburghe, I would just ignore but keep all the letters until it stops. But that's nothing unique - that's what we've been doing here for a decade and was the default advice before POPLA existed as an appeals system. You missed it. Never mind, move on and don't pay them.
